What this means

This registration is in, or will soon enter, a USPTO maintenance window. Missing a Section 8 or Section 9 filing can cancel the registration.

Status 700: Status 700 means the trademark is registered and active on the Principal Register. You have nationwide rights for the listed goods and services and may use ®. Section 8 maintenance is due between years five and six.

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
025A-shirts; Ankle socks; Bathrobes; Boxer briefs; Boxer shorts; Denim jackets; Denim pants; Denim shorts; Denims; Flannel shirts; Fleece pullovers; Fleece shorts; Hooded pullovers; Hooded sweat shirts; Hooded sweatshirts; Hoodies; Hoods; Jogging pants; Knit shirts; Long-sleeved shirts; Lounge pants; Men's socks; Mocknecks; Polo shirts; Pullovers; Shirts; Shorts; Sleepwear; Socks; Sweat pants; Sweat shirts; Sweatpants; Sweatshirts; T-shirts; Tee shirts; Tee-shirts; Trousers; Turtlenecks; all of the foregoing made in whole or substantial part of cottonACTIVEJul 1, 2020
